摘要
故障诊断及纠错是离散事件系统研究热点之一,主要研究在控制器实施控制的情况下,如何对离散事件系统的故障实行纠错,使系统运行在可接受状态范围内.通过对可纠错状态的形式化,提出了一种基于系统状态圈的纠错方法,给出了构造纠错控制器的算法.在探讨多次状态转移时故障事件规律发生的基础上,给出了系统的最小可纠错状态集的具体计算方法,提出了在最小状态集下离散事件系统控制器的构造方法,并给出了一种控制器实施控制的方案.
Failure diagnosability and correctability of discrete-event systems are widely studied. In this paper,we mainly focus on how to correct failure events of discrete-event systems( DESs) under the condition that the controller takes control,for making the system run within accepted states.With the formalization of correctable states and events,we propose a correct method based on cycles of system's states. Meanwhile,a controller-construct algorithm is proposed.After discussing the rule of failure event's occurrence while system's states change substantially,we present respectively a method to calculate the minimal set of states such that the system can be corrected and a feasible solution for the corrected system based on the minimal set of states.
出处
《云南大学学报(自然科学版)》
CAS
CSCD
北大核心
2015年第2期187-193,共7页
Journal of Yunnan University(Natural Sciences Edition)
基金
国家自然科学基金(61273118)
广东省高校省级重大科研项目(2014KZDXM033)
广东省自然科学基金(S2012010010570)
关键词
离散事件系统
容错系统
可纠错性
discrete-event system
fault-tolerate system
correctability